chugged

Meaning of chugged

verb, past tense
  1. (of a vehicle or boat) move slowly making regular muffled explosive sounds, as of an engine running slowly.
    a cabin cruiser was chugging down the river

mid 19th century (as a noun): imitative.

verb, past tense
  1. consume (a drink) in large gulps without pausing.
    she chugged a glass of cola

1950s: imitative.
